2017-06-21 77 views
0

我试图显示页面项目上的clob列。但是,它显示了以下错误消息:如何在页面项目APEX上显示clob列数据?

我已经做了以下内容:

  1. 创建只显示页面项目。

  2. 添加PLSQL函数返回到页面项目与下面的代码:

    DECLARE 
    L_CLOB CLOB; 
    begin 
    select p_data INTO l_clob from testdel; 
    :P2_NEW := L_CLOB; 
    END; 
    
  3. 但是,它显示为错误消息。

我想返回超过4000个字符。但是,没有成功。

计算页面项目P2_NEW的项目源值时出错。

ORA-06502:PL/SQL:数字或值错误

回答

0

我认为你正在做的事情错了,请尝试使用下面的说明。存储在表

数据长度:> 4000

Data lenght

  • 首先创建项作为显示仅

Item Property

  • 物品来源

Item Source

  • 项目输出

Item OUtput

请让我知道如果任何问题出现。 谢谢。

+0

谢谢你的回复ashish。如果clob列低于4000个字符,您的解决方案就可以工作。但是,如果它超过4000个字符,那么它会将错误引发为“ORA-06502:PL/SQL:数字或值错误”。 –

+0

不,你可以看到我附加了物品输出的屏幕截图,物品中存储的字符超过4000个。 你正在使用哪个版本???? 我在5.1上做过 –

相关问题